WISBECH Grammar School's first XV rugby team reached the semi-final of the Eastern Counties under-18 cup before losing 27-0 to Norwich School.
Wisbech found this a hard game, fielding the same boys who had played in a tough encounter against Wymondham on the previous Saturday and with the pack still weakened by injuries.
The Norwich back row and full back proved difficult for Wisbech to handle, and Norwich scored decisive tries in last Tuesday's match.
There was good news, however, for one member of the team, Henry Bowlby, who has been selected for the Eastern Counties under-18s team.
The Wisbech team, which was unbeaten in all its matches in the first half of the term, beat Gresham's School 29-7 and Saffron Walden County High School 25-24 in earlier rounds of the competition.
In the first half of the term the boys recorded victories against Hampshire Collegiate College (24-19), Culford School (41-3), King's School, Grantham (21-3), Langley School (29-15) and King's School, Ely (22-8).
